Your financial plan may include a variety of financial solutions, such
as cash management strategies, investments and insurance. It's essential
to maintain cash reserves that you can access quickly, without penalties
or loss of value. In addition to cash reserves to cover unexpected costs,
you might want to consider the following types of insurance:
- Life
insurance: Some policies help cover short-term concerns
and lifetime policies can better protect your financial plan. Certain
products are designed to minimize long-term costs, reduce current
income taxes and more.
- Long-term
care insurance: According to the U.S. Department of
Health and Human Services, about 42% of Americans who reach age 65
will need long-term care at some point in their lives. Budgeting
for this type of insurance can help you protect your financial future.
- Disability
insurance: Without proper protection, a disabling injury
or illness puts your family's lifestyle at risk. Different policies
have different benefit terms, periods and definitions of disability.
- Auto
and home insurance: As your automobile(s) and home values
increase or decrease over time, make sure your coverage is current
and comprehensive.
